First, understand what "new" can mean. It might be a recently constructed community or an established organization that has renovated or adopted innovative care programs. In either case, focus on the philosophy behind the walls. Newer communities often emphasize more private apartments, open common areas to reduce isolation, and technology for safety, like discreet fall monitoring systems. For a town like West Newbury, where winters can be quiet and sometimes isolating, a community's design that encourages social interaction in bright, inviting spaces is particularly valuable. Ask about how they facilitate connections, not just during planned activities, but in the daily flow of life.
Your search should extend beyond West Newbury to nearby towns like Newburyport, Amesbury, and Haverhill, where new developments are more common. While proximity is ideal for regular visits, don't limit your options too strictly. A slightly longer drive to a community that perfectly aligns with your parent's needs is often better than a closer compromise. Consider the journey you'll make regularly—are the routes manageable year-round? When you visit, which you absolutely must do, go beyond the tour. Try to visit during a meal or an activity. Observe the interactions between staff and residents. Do they know residents by name? Is the atmosphere calm and respectful? This tells you more about the culture than any brochure.
For West Newbury families, local integration is a key point of inquiry. Does the new community have connections to our area? Do they arrange outings to local favorites like Mill Pond or the West Newbury Farmers Market? Do they welcome community groups in for performances or shared meals? This connection can help ease the transition, making the new residence feel less like a separate institution and more like an extension of the familiar community. Also, inquire specifically about how they handle healthcare coordination. With major hospitals like Anna Jaques in Newburyport and Lahey in nearby Burlington, understanding how the community manages transportation and communication with local medical providers is crucial.
